Bought it a couple weeks ago for $150 on Craigslist. I believe from the body, neck, and the oversized control plate that it was originally a BLACK AND CHROME. Came with:
  • a BWB pickguard that the owner had warped all to hell by sticking his picks under it
  • a Seymour Duncan Quarter Pounder for strat rigged up to a tele bridge pickup baseplate
  • a surprisingly good MIM strat neck pickup fit through a normal tele neck pickup slot on the pg by not having a cover on it
  • reverse control plate
  • MATCHING HEADSTOCK
  • stupid dice knobs and switch tip
I HAD EVERY PROBLEM IN THE UNIVERSE SETTING THIS THING UP. When I first opened in, the wiring was hideous. The leads on both pickups had been snipped to the bobbin and then patched together out of several 3-6 cm long pieces of wire. They were frayed really near the pickup on the strat neck pup, so I just replaced them entirely by soldering new wires right on to where the copper windings meet the leads. I don't know why I was so freaked out about this like it would kill the pickup, but it was way easy.

List of bullshit that occurred:
  • GFS pickguard with strat slot doesn't fit with oversized control plate. Switch out with a spare.
  • Wire it all up with GFS rails bucker in Robroe cover in neck and GFS Tele PROFESSIONAL SERIES 63 in bridge. Bridge pickup is quiet. Freak out.
  • Assume its the treble bleed cap or 500k pots I put in, replace entirely with two 1M pots wired as 2 volume.
  • Still doesn't sound right. Throw switch in trash, replace with spare.
  • Realize the neck pickup is the problem and the previous switch was wired backward. Great.
  • THROW ALL THAT SHIT OUT THE WINDOW. Neck bucker, switch both go in trash.
  • Now wired: 500k vol with Treble Bleed, 500k Tone, Mexi neck pup, 63 bridge, confirmed functional switch.
  • Have to take off the neck, bridge, and pickguard to replace neck pickup.
  • Mexi neck pickup barely fits in the body's route due to thickness of wire and tightness of space, have to bop it with my fist to snap it into the pickup route. First time I do this, it severs the ground lead. Re-replaced ground lead. Doesn't sever the second time I bop it into place.
  • GFS pickguard warps a little due to tight fit. Sticks up as though I had kept picks in the top bout for a long time. KILL ME.
  • FINALLY EVERYTHING FUNCTIONS. String it up only to discover.
  • OF FUCKING COURSE THE PICKUPS ARE OUT OF PHASE.
That's omitting little shit like stripped screwholes and that. Basically, if I ever see the inside of this guitar again, I'll smash it. But, now, it looks rad and sounds FREAKING AWESOME. The GFS Profesh Series is officially SHAD APPROVED, because this bridge pickup is bangin'. The two pickups sound great together, and, like I said, the strat neck pickup was pretty great. I see now why so many dudes replace the usual tele neck pups with them. It gives major MARTY STUART vibes.

The matching headstock is fresh to death, doe. This is also my only tele with a reversed control plate, and I kind of dig it.
